Travel Program
Representing Rockbridge County Proudly
The RUSC Travel Program is the highest level of play within the club. Teams will compete with surrounding communities throughout the western side of Virginia and seek to push themselves competitively. Many players who participate in the program go on to play and feature for local high school programs and possibly beyond in collegiate play.
This program focuses on individual growth, team development, and building lifelong friendships in a competitive and supportive environment. Participation requires a significant amount of commitment and dedication. Coaches seek to form competitive team environments that will push players to grow and develop as soccer players but also have fun and play the game of soccer with other like minded players. All players must go through an evaluation process to be selected for the team and full participation in team events is expected.

Team Commitment
Travel Teams practice two times per week with matches on the weekends (mostly Saturdays, but some Sunday play is possible). This involves an 8-10 game season, half of which are played in Lexington or Rockbridge County. Teams are expected to compete in one out-of-town tournament per season.
Teams in the U11 through U13 age groups will participate in both the fall and spring seasons. Players at this level often progress on to play high school soccer. Therefore, U14 and older teams will only participate in the fall season to avoid conflicts with high school play.

League Play
RUSC Travel teams compete in the VCSL (Virginia Club Soccer League). Divisions are formed from neighboring communities in the western part of the state of Virginia. Teams will play a minimum of 8 league matches per season with half of those matches at home in Rockbridge County and the remainder away. Additional friendly matches and other games will be at the discretion of the program coordinator and team coaches.

Tryouts
All Players must go through an evaluation or tryout to be selected for the Travel program. The annual tryouts are typically held in May for the next year of play. Other tryout opportunities will be identified as positions on teams allow throughout the year. Players who do not make the game roster may be invited to join as practice players at a reduced cost.

Registration Fees
$400 per season.
U11 thru U13 teams are expected to participate in both the fall and the spring season.
U14 and older teams will just participate in the Fall season.
*Uniforms must be purchased separately from capellisport.com. Team Uniforms are on a two year cycle and may be used again when possible. Selected players will be sent ordering information directly at the start of each year. Registration fees do not cover travel or accommodation costs for team events

Financial Assistance
The purpose of the RUSC Financial Aid program is to provide financial support for families with the greatest need so that they may participate in RUSC programs without financial hardship. Financial aid is available in the fall and spring for qualifying families in the Recreation, Challenge and Travel programs based on demonstrated need and RUSC’s ability to fund the assistance.
FINANCIAL AID APPLICATION AND APPROVAL
All families requesting financial aid must complete a Financial Aid Form. All financial aid requests will be reviewed by staff and will be kept confidential. Applicants for financial aid MUST APPLY EACH TAX YEAR (April 15-April 15), with complete and current Information. The level of aid for which an applicant qualifies can be requested for programs throughout the year. However, each financial aid request must be approved for each program. Each financial aid request is subject to available funds. Any financial aid awards given will apply only to the current program registration.
